Technical
OS | Android v13 | Android v13 |
Custom UI | MIUI 14 | Redmagic OS 6 |
Chipset | Mediatek Dimensity 9200 Plus |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en2 |
CPU | 3.05 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 3.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Core Details | 1x Cortex-X3@3.05 GHz & 3x Cortex-A715@2.85 GHz & 4x Cortex-A510@1.8 GHz | 1x Cortex-X3@ 3.2GHz & 4x Cortex-A715@ 2.8GHz & 3x Cortex-A510@2.0 GHz |
GPU | Immortalis-G715 MC11 | Adreno 740 |
